    Yeah, lock it in at 1.5 volts if that's the spec and try it..Might want to clear CMOS to put everything back to default settings, try it, then start tweaking settings manually from there if you still have problems..Exactly what RAM were you using before?..Also, the NVIDIA SATA drivers for that board sometimes caused freezing, see post #3 here..What OS are you running, btw?
